Analytik Jena, a leading provider of analytical measurement technology, extends her portfolio to chemical elementary analysis with the new Creature 9200 ICP-OES series. The devices combine spectral resolution with a high mesh with high uterine tolerance and allow accurate analyzes even for complex samples. With the most compact footprint in their class, they also set new standards in terms of laboratory efficiency. The series is designed to determine high resolution of various elements – especially in complex matrizes, such as organic. This makes the plasmaquant 9200 ideal for applications in research, trace analysis and quality control.

The formal version Creature 9200 It offers an analysis of 6 pm @ 200 Nm and is tailored to usual use in contract control and quality control laboratories. THE Elite Plasmaquant 9200 The version achieves a analysis of 2 pm @ 200 Nm and designed for particularly demanding samples – for example in the electroplating/metal industry and specialty chemicals industry. A wide spectral range of 160 to 900 Nm, low detection limits and high long-term stability allows reliable results in a wide range of applications-from battery production and petrochemicals to metal and metal resolution.

The size of the new instrument has decreased by more than 40 percent compared to the previous model-by making the most compact imprint on the ICP-OES market. With only 60 cm wide, the often limited laboratory space can be effectively used. Thanks to a starting time of less than ten minutes, the device is ready for use especially quickly, which greatly speeds up the working processes. With a powerful creature of plasma up to 1,700 watts, it can also handle reliable difficult matrices.
